Virlan is a boy’s name of English origin, meaning “Likely a modern invented name, possibly a combination of Vir- and -lan. It doesn't have a concrete historical meaning.”. It currently ranks #6417 in the US, and peaked in popularity in 2018.

Hudson
English
Meaning
Derived from an English surname, meaning "son of Hudd". Hudd is a medieval diminutive of Hugh, derived from the Germanic element "hugu" meaning "heart, mind, spirit".
